MANCHESTER CITY players ditched the expensive bars and clubs for a disused warehouse in town to celebrate their title triumph.

Pep Guardiola's men hoisted the Premier League trophy aloft on Sunday after their draw with Huddersfield.

And that was just the beginning of their celebrations this weekend as they got into the Bank Holiday spirit.

City players headed to a derelict warehouse near Manchester Piccadilly Station to carry on the title party.

Temperance Street was closed to traffic and taken over by the new Premier League champions.

Security guards marshalled the entrances while flashy cars carrying City stars arrived at the venue.

Kevin de Bruyne posted an Instagram video showing himself, Kyle Walker and John Stones enjoying a song and dance.

Bernardo Silva and Gabriel Jesus also came dressed to impress at the title celebrations.

Danilo, meanwhile, posted a photo on Instagram of him and his partner looking stylish before the event.

When Man City clinched the title on April 15 after Man United's loss to West Brom, a lot of the players were out of the country and not there to celebrate.

But they all joined in on Sunday night to celebrate a stunning campaign that sealed a third Premier League title in seven seasons.
